The original Dragon Quest III, released in 1988 in Japan and later in North America and Europe, was a landmark game that set the standard for future RPGs. It introduced several features that became staples in the series, including a deep character customization system and an expansive open world to explore. The game's success can be attributed to its rich storytelling, challenging gameplay, and the charm of its characters.

The core appeal of Dragon Quest III lies in its tactical freedom. You begin your journey as the child of the legendary hero Ortega. Upon turning 16, you are tasked by the King of Aliahan to defeat the Archfiend Baramos.

For those unfamiliar with Dragon Quest III, the game follows the story of a hero tasked with saving the world from the evil Baramos. The gameplay revolves around exploration, character development, and turn-based combat. The HD-2D Remake retains the core gameplay mechanics, with some tweaks to make the experience more accessible to new players. The HD-2D Remake of Dragon Quest III promises to breathe new life into this classic title, with a host of exciting features and improvements. The game's graphics have been completely overhauled, with a stunning HD-2D visual style that brings the game's world and characters to life in a way that is both nostalgic and modern. The game's soundtrack, composed by the renowned Koichi Sugiyama, has also been reorchestrated to provide a rich and immersive audio experience.

Dragon Quest III HD-2D Remake is a role-playing game developed by ArtePiazza and published by Square Enix. The game is a remastered version of the 1988 classic, Dragon Quest III: The Seeds of Salvation.

The DRAGON QUEST III HD-2D Remake on Nintendo Switch is a loving reimagining of a classic RPG. The beautiful visuals, reorchestrated soundtrack, and refined gameplay mechanics come together to create an engaging experience that's both nostalgic and fresh. While some purists might lament the changes, the remake's accessibility and enhancements make it an excellent entry point for new players and a satisfying revisit for veterans.
